RSSB Recruitment 2025: The Rajasthan Staff Selection Board (RSSB) Recruitment 2025 recently concluded its massive hiring campaign for over 13,000 government jobs across the health sector. This recruitment drive, which officially closed applications on May 1, 2025, was one of the most significant public sector hiring efforts in Rajasthan in recent years. It opened doors for thousands of aspirants seeking stable, well-paying roles under the National Health Mission (NHM) and Rajasthan Medical Education Society (RajMES).

RSSB Recruitment 2025
Here’s a quick overview of the most important details:
Feature | Details |
---|---|
Total Vacancies | 13,252 |
Application Period | April 2, 2025 – May 1, 2025 |
Recruiting Authorities | Rajasthan NHM, RajMES |
Roles Offered | CHO, Nurse, Lab Technician, DEO, Accounts Assistant, Pharma Assistant |
Eligibility | 12th pass (Science) + relevant diploma/degree (varies by post) |
Application Fee | ₹600 (General/OBC); ₹400 (SC/ST/OBC-NCL/PwBD) |
Exam Date | June 2025 |
Result Announcement | November 2025 |
Official Website | rssb.rajasthan.gov.in |

Breakdown of Major Job Categories
Community Health Officers (CHOs)
- Primary Responsibilities: Manage wellness centers, deliver frontline care, handle basic diagnosis.
- Qualifications: B.Sc Nursing / GNM with Bridge Program in Community Health.
Lab Technicians
- Primary Responsibilities: Collect and process samples, conduct tests, maintain lab reports.
- Qualifications: Diploma in Medical Lab Technology.
Data Entry Operators (DEOs)
- Responsibilities: Handle patient records, digital data management.
- Qualifications: 12th pass with Computer Diploma (DOEACC/CCC Level A or equivalent).
Pharma Assistants
- Duties: Dispense medication, maintain drug inventory, support pharmacists.
- Qualifications: Diploma in Pharmacy or B.Pharm.
